- Description: At Pacific City, Chief Kiawanda Rock looms 327 feet above sea level, and is the tallest of Oregon's coastal Haystack Rocks. The other two, found off Cannon Beach and Bandon's Devil's Kitchen Wayside, stand at 235 feet and 105 feet, respectively. All are included within Oregon Islands National Wildlife Refuge, and all provide essential breeding and resting habitat for seabirds and marine mammals. For surfers, the perfect wave might last an average of only ten seconds. As the waves roll in around Haystack Rock, they form some of the most unique curls along the Pacific Ocean.
